Retail audit of the Russian pharmaceutical market
Retail audit database combines information about drugs, nutrition supplements (NS), cosmetics and other parapharmaceutics sales through pharmacy outlets, including sales within DLO Program. More info
Reimbursement supply in Moscow and St.Petersburg
Database consists of information about drugs supply within reimbursement program to the citizens of Moscow (federal and regional lists) and St.Petersburg (regional list). Data is given without extrapolation.
Hospital audit of the Russian pharmaceutical market
DSM Group offers database made jointly with Aston Consulting company. Hospital audit database is a result of monitoring of drugs purchases by Russian hospitals, including DLO program. More info
DLO database
Monitoring of drugs sales within federal reimbursement program. More info
Drugs and substances import database
DSM Group offers import database made jointly with Diamond Vision company. The base is a result of monitoring of import-export operations of pharmaceutical goods (drugs and substances) for the period from January 1998 up to present time. More info
Multifactor analysis of competitors surrounding
When you plan a new product launch strategy, or improving positions of existing brands, it is necessary to analyze the whole pharmaceutical market, its segments, and also competitors surrounding of the brand as well. DSM CR is product of multifactor analysis of competitors surrounding within a particular product group.
DSM CR lets you make your own data segmentation using information from pharmacies (retail audit), hospitals (hospitals audit), DLO and import.
DSM CR uses the following data fields:
- Sales values and sales volumes of market participants
- Number of trade names, their sale values
- Wholesale and retail prices, retail markup
- Availability of trade position
- Average pharmacies purchase
- Profit share of the trade position in pharmacies
- Quantitative figures of competitive group
- Weighted figures of trade positions
- Potential share of trade positions
- Trade groups maps
These figures give to the analyst an opportunity:
- To define maximum attractive brands for pharmacies and end-consumers
- To estimate an assortment niche potential
- To estimate brand promotion efficiency
- To choose optimal promotional strategy for a brand

Specialized pharmaceutical mass-media. Pharmacies’ staff estimation
The aim of the project is to estimate the popularity of specialized pharmaceutical periodicals be pharmacies workers.
Research contents:
- Rating of information sources (for pharmacies workers)
- Rating of specialized pharmaceutical periodicals
- Rating of specialized pharmaceutical periodicals in different Russian regions
- The ways of receiving pharmaceutical periodicals by pharmacies workers
- The pharmacies workers estimation of particular themes and rubrics in pharmaceutical periodicals
- APPENDIX: Rating of specialized pharmaceutical periodicals in some Russian regions
Sample parameters:
- Researching method: questioning (standard questionnaire)
- Responders: pharmacies managers and pharmacists
- Regional cover: Moscow, Moscow region, St.Petersburg, Nizhniy Novgorod, Yekaterinburg, Novosibirsk, Rostov-On-Don, Kazan, Vladivostok, Perm, Ufa, Samara, Chelyabinsk, Volgograd, Voronezh, Krasnodar, Krasnoyarsk.
- Sample: 1 800 questionnaires
- Periodicity: twice a year
- Reporting forms: presentations, comments
